Ticket: Crashfall ingest failing on staging

New folks, please read carefully. The Pebblekit mobile app's crash reports aren't reaching the symbolication queue because staging's env file was copied without its upload credential. Symptoms: 401s in the collector logs every five minutes. To fix, add the missing line to the env file, exactly as follows.

secret setting of fafop-tagep: VAULT_KEY29=6a815d21e2d77cc25ef1802d73ee6

Attendees agreed the signed Varent licensing contracts will travel in a tamper-evident pouch, logged at both ends. The receiving site must check the seal number against the manifest before signing acceptance, and any discrepancy pauses the hand-over immediately. Reception should keep the pouch in the locked cabinet until Ms. Derring collects it personally that afternoon. The courier has been briefed on timing and route. The exact hand-over instruction for the courier is noted below.

handover note for hafop-tajep: the juldor kelix courier leaves the lamdor ledger at gate 2709 under passcode 256550

Autocomplete index rebuilds on the Quillbrook search cluster are running 6x slower since last night's deploy. Cause: the Fenwright tokenizer update disabled batch flushes, so every document commits individually. Mitigation: roll back the tokenizer package on the index workers, then trigger a full rebuild from the Harlow snapshot. Do not restart the query nodes mid-rebuild; partial segments will serve garbage suggestions. Expect roughly 40 minutes to recover. The affected build's trace token is below.

build token for kagaf-hahof: htk14_9d3d4d26d7d8de

## Deployment

SplitSnap is the little service that ingests timing-chip reads at the finish mats and pushes splits to the Runfest dashboard. Deploys are boring on purpose: build the container, push to the internal registry, restart the unit on the trackside box. It picks up its settings on boot, so double-check them before race day. Here's the current config it expects.

settings of tagef-bawif:
DRUIX_HOST=druix.zemvarlabs.internal
DRUIX_PORT=8000